在这个示例中,我们通过设置API密钥,构造请求参数,发送POST请求,最后解析响应获取生成的文本。注意这里的api.example.com需要替换为实际的ChatGPT API地址,v1/generate为具体的接口地址。此外,为了正常运行这段代码,你需要在环境变量中设置GPT2_TOKEN,这个token用于获取和验证API的访问权限。二、开发自己的智能聊天机器人...
首先,我们需要创建一个ChatGPT引擎。在Python中,可以使用以下代码创建一个新的ChatGPT引擎: from chatterbot import ChatBot from chatterbot.trainers import ChatGPTTrainer chatbot = ChatBot('Example Bot') chatbot.set_trainer(ChatGPTTrainer) 在这里,我们使用了ChatGPTTrainer作为我们的训练器。ChatGPTTrainer是与Ch...
最后就可以在终端运行下面的代码了, streamlit run example.py 我们在浏览器中打开页面,例如我们点击进入“AI聊天”这个模块,我们可以看到右上角处于RUNNING的状态,表示正在运行中,等会儿之后就能看到结果 而点击进入“AI绘画”这个模块,例如想要绘制可爱的猫咪,我们也能看到如下的结果 Python还总是入不了门? 小编创...
在OpenAI Python 库中,嵌入将文本字符串表示为浮点数的固定长度向量。嵌入旨在衡量文本字符串之间的相似性或相关性。 要获取文本字符串的嵌入,您可以使用 Python 中的 embeddings 方法,如下所示: importopenaiimportosos.environ["http_proxy"]="http://127.0.0.1:10809"os.environ["https_proxy"]="http://127.0...
2.2 使用Python给微信发信息 然后,我们在ChatGPT对话框中输入:使用Python给微信发信息 ChatGPT给出解决方案如下图所示: 2.3 使用Python发送电子邮件 我们使用搜索引擎寻找相关发送邮件的代码片段,搜索出来的结果可能会有很多代码片段展示如何使用Python发送电子邮件。我们可以使用ChatGPT来更具体一些,比如我们输入:从“email...
streamlit run example.py 我们在浏览器中打开页面,例如我们点击进入“AI聊天”这个模块,我们可以看到右上角处于RUNNING的状态,表示正在运行中,等会儿之后就能看到结果 而点击进入“AI绘画”这个模块,例如想要绘制可爱的猫咪,我们也能看到如下的结果 本篇教程只是针对OpenAI里面各种接口的调用,大家可以在此基础上在进行...
cp .env.example .env 5. 使用您喜欢的文本编辑器打开.env文件,并将您的密钥添加到OPENAI_API_KEY行。我们正在使用纳米: sudo nano .env 2. 运行您的应用程序 1、一一运行以下命令: python3 -m venv venv。venv/bin/activate pip install -rrequirements.txtflask ...
Generate a Python Function with ChatGPT For this example, I asked ChatGPT to “write me a Python function that trims a specified character from a string.” The answer I get back is plain and simple: def trim_char(string, char): """ This function takes a string and a character and re...
编写一个自动化网络设巡检python程序 为了编写一个自动化网络设备巡检的Python程序,你需要遵循以下步骤: 导入必要的库和模块。这些可能包括 Paramiko、Netmiko、Ping、Requests 等。例如: 代码语言:javascript 复制 pythonCopy codeimport paramiko from netmikoimportConnectHandlerimportsubprocessimportrequests ...
很久之前,我让ChatGPT模拟虚拟机,并让它写了一个Python代码,代码的作用是生成前100个素数,下面是它给的代码: 这是一段很糟糕的代码,有一个“1002”的hardcode,以及它的效率很低,为了判断某个数num能不能被其它数 i 整除,它遍历了从2到num-1的数,更好的做法是只遍历到num的平方根即可。 我需要不断地告诉...